The making of a ‘publizen’
, Linton Weeks, the Washington Post
A culture of blogs and camera phones is shaping a generation that lacks a sense of privacy.

Google Dave Feinman.

Go ahead. Really. He wants you to.

Type his name as one word and you will soon know a lot about him — through his home page and blog on MySpace.com and the Web site that bears his name. He’s 27, engaged, Jewish, a Gemini and graduate student at the University of Central Florida who likes Beavis and Butt-head. He will soon be interning in the office of Rep. Robert Wexler, D-Boca Raton. Coincidentally, Wexler’s office is the subject of a TV documentary series that premieres this month.

“I don’t put anything on MySpace that I wouldn’t say to the face of anyone I meet,” says Feinman. The Internet is “a very good way to express my feelings about politics or personal things.”

Feinman is a primo example of an emerging archetype: the very public citizen. A “publizen.”
